Mount Dare Hotel is a legendary outback pub and roadhouse perched on the edge of the Simpson Desert in the Northern Territory. This remote, character-filled oasis offers a genuine taste of Australian frontier life, with cold beer, hearty meals, and a warm welcome for travelers tackling the rugged Birdsville Track or exploring the vast desert landscapes. It's a must-stop for self-drive adventurers seeking an authentic outback experience.
Highlights & What to See
- Outback Pub Atmosphere: Soak up the history and character of the iconic Mount Dare Hotel, where travelers swap stories over a cold beer in the bar.
- Simpson Desert Access: Use Mount Dare as your launching point for venturing into the Simpson Desert, including the famous French Line and Rig Road.
- Witjira National Park: Explore the nearby Dalhousie Springs, a series of natural thermal artesian springs perfect for a relaxing soak.
- Birdsville Track: Drive a section of this historic stock route, connecting Mount Dare to Birdsville in Queensland, with stark desert scenery.
- Star Gazing: With minimal light pollution, the night skies here are spectacular – ideal for astronomy enthusiasts.
Suggested Time to Spend
Most travelers spend one night at Mount Dare Hotel to rest and resupply before continuing their journey. If you plan to explore the Simpson Desert or Witjira National Park, allow at least two to three days in the area. Start early to make the most of daylight hours for driving on unsealed roads.
Nearby Areas Worth Combining
- Dalhousie Springs – a short drive north, these thermal springs offer a unique desert soak.
- Birdsville – the remote Queensland town at the end of the Birdsville Track.
- Oodnadatta Track – another iconic outback route with historic ruins and the famous Pink Roadhouse.
- Coober Pedy – the opal mining town with underground homes and moonscape scenery.
- Lake Eyre – Australia's largest salt lake, often dry but spectacular after rare rains.
